Spring Produce Is Popping!


May brings that first real taste of spring.
Farmers markets are overflowing with asparagus, radishes, spring onions, tender greens, mushrooms, and maybe even the first strawberries if you're lucky.

Meals start to feel lighter, fresher, and easier to throw together.

Recipe: Spicy Hummus with Harissa

This hummus recipe is wonderful as a dip, but I love it as a spread on a spring veggie focused sandwich!

I love to add radishes, spinach, and green onions between two sourdough slices slathered with this delicious Spicy Hummus recipe.

Smart Seasonal Tips for May

Level Up Your Meals With This Simple Trick:
Fresh herbs on everything!

I’ve been chopping herbs straight into salads, tossing them on grain bowls, spooning them over pastas, sprinkling into sandwiches, and blending right into dressings.

I especially love using spring herbs as a finishing touch, just a handful over roasted veggies or a finished dish with a squeeze of lemon or drizzle of good olive oil.

It’s such a simple move, but it instantly elevates the meal and makes it feel like a special little occasion, just for you.
